NEW YORK – The U.S. national team will play exhibition games in Las Vegas, New York, Chicago and the Canary Islands before this summer's World Cup of Basketball.

The Americans will begin their training in Las Vegas and will play an intrasquad exhibition game Aug. 1 at the Thomas & Mack Center.

The Americans will play Brazil on Aug. 16 in Chicago, before games at Madison Square Garden in New York against the Dominican Republic on Aug. 20 and Puerto Rico two days later. The training tour wraps up against Slovenia on Aug. 26 at the Canary Islands.

The schedule was announced Wednesday by USA Basketball.

The World Cup of Basketball runs Aug. 30 to Sept. 14 in Spain. The United States is the defending world champion.
